Is it just me, or has anyone else ran into charging problems in the past week with their Galaxy S22 after the new UX updates? My phone has stopped charging properly and while plugged in, its battery level rises and falls while not in use. I watched it go from 98%, to 92%, up to 97%, plateau, and then drop to 94%. All while not being used. I tried fiddling with charging settings and got no fixes to the problem and this is bugging me because I already replaced my phone with this one through insurance just about three weeks ago.
